Begin by combining the ketchup, hot sauce, and white vinegar in a bowl. Stir the ingredients together until they are well combined. Then, add the garlic powder, onion powder, and cumin to the mixture. Season the sauce with salt and pepper to your liking, and stir until all the ingredients are fully incorporated.

Directions. Stir together tomato sauce, water, vinegar, cumin, onion powder, garlic powder, garlic salt, chili powder, paprika, sugar, and cayenne pepper in a saucepan. Bring to a simmer over low heat and cook until slightly thickened, about 20 minutes. Cool sauce slightly before serving. I Made It.

Instructions. In a medium saucepan, whisk together tomato sauce, water, 2 tablespoons white vinegar, hot sauce, sugar, salt, garlic powder, onion powder and cumin. Bring to a boil and then reduce heat to low or medium low. Simmer where the sauce is steadily bubbling for 15 minutes.

Homemade taco sauce is made with a base of tomato, vinegar for acidity, a touch of sugar and several spices like chili powder, cumin and garlic for flavor. Why we love this recipe.
